When urged to explain what he conceived as this "something else," he
would answer--

"There has always been 'something else' in our environment,--
something that stupid humanity has taken centuries to discover.
Sound-waves for example--light-rays,--electricity--these have been
freely at our service from the beginning. Electricity might have
been used ages ago, had not dull-witted man refused to find anything
better for lighting purposes than an oil-lamp or a tallow candle!
If, in past periods, he had been told 'there is something else'--he
would have laughed his informant to scorn. So with our blundering
methods of living--'there is something else'--not after death, but
NOW and HERE. We are going about in the darkness with a candle when
a great force of wider light is all round us, only awaiting
connection and application to our uses."
